Things to Consider when choosing Cargo Insurance

1. You’ll want to make sure your commodity is covered. Don’t assume that all loads will be covered. Some goods like tobacco, jewelry, and liquor are hard to find coverage for since they are prime targets of thieves. Make sure your agent knows what you will be hauling.  2. READ MORE >>

Physical Damage Values - Picking the Right Amount

Picking the Right Amount ·         It’s crucial to provide an accurate stated amount. Since the insurance company pays the lesser of ACV and the Stated Amount, it does you no good to value your truck higher than it’s actually worth. READ MORE >>
